** Cancelled Due to Illness – March 13th – Falmouth Half Marathon – Falmouth half details

The race is both hilly and scenic, starting and finishing at The Moor in Falmouth. After heading out to Gyllngvase Beach, runners are directed towards Swanpool and Maenporth beaches before going inland to Mawnan Smith and Buddock Water before turning back through Penryn and along the coast again back into Falmouth.
